How do I fix Disney+ that will not load on a Hisense smart TV?

Answer

Power-cycle the Hisense TV, update Disney+ from the Google Play Store on the TV, then check for a TV system software update. A stuck loader is often fixed by a cold reboot plus app and firmware updates before you remove the account.

Before you start: stop right away if…

  • Clearing app data signs you out of Disney+ on that TV and removes local app data.

Follow these steps

  1. Power-cycle the Hisense TV

    Turn the TV off, unplug it from power for 30 to 60 seconds, plug it back in, wait for a full boot, then open Disney+ again.

    You should see: The TV restarts cleanly and Disney+ either loads or fails in a clearer way.

  2. Update Disney+ on the TV

    Open the Google Play Store on the Hisense TV, find Disney+, and install any available update. If your Hisense uses a different app store, open that store’s Disney+ listing instead.

    You should see: Disney+ shows as up to date on the TV.

  3. Check Hisense system software

    Open the TV Settings and look for System, Support, or About menus with System update / Software update. Install any available TV firmware update, then reboot if prompted.

    You should see: The TV reports it is up to date, or finishes installing a new system update.

  4. Clear Disney+ cache if it still will not open

    Go to Settings > Apps (wording varies), open Disney+, and clear cache. Open Disney+ again before choosing clear data, which usually requires signing in again.

    You should see: Disney+ launches to the home or sign-in screen instead of an endless load.

  5. Reinstall Disney+ as a last app step

    If it still will not load, uninstall Disney+ from the TV app list, reinstall from the official store, sign in on the TV, and test a title.

    You should see: A fresh Disney+ install opens and starts streaming, or shows a specific account/error message.

Extra tips

What to look for: Disney+ stuck on loading, closing immediately, or showing an error on a Hisense smart TV, while other apps may still work.

Before you change anything: Confirm the Disney+ subscription works on a phone or computer if possible. Note any exact error text on the TV. Prefer updates and reboot before clearing all app data. Never share passwords or codes with unexpected callers.
